What Halo 6 Definitely Needs...

With E3 right around the corner at this point, we are bound to get a Halo 6 announcement. It's inevitable. However, after the mixed reception for Halo 5: Guardians, people r starting to think that Halo 6 is gonna flop. Well, here's what I think Halo 6 needs in order to be successful. 1) A better story: With Brian Reed out of the picture, I believe that this is a great opportunity for 343 to create a story that fills all of the plot holes that Halo 5 created while also delivering a darker tale. 2) Brutes: 343, BRING BACK THE BRUTES!!! U and Creative Assembly brought the Brutes back in a major way in Halo Wars 2 with the introduction of The Banished, so bring them back in Halo 6! 3) In-Depth Armor Customization: I'm talking Halo Reach/ Halo 4 level armor customization! The fans have been wanting it for a LONG time, now is the time to give it to us. 4) Better art direction: Use the art style from Halo Wars 2 and bring it into Halo 6. 5) NO req. system: For us to earn our gear through daily challenges and achievements like in Halo 3 and Reach. Give us something to work towards and reward us for our work.

          • I disagree, I'm fine with the story, req system, and armor customization. If I can't have two different shoulder pads, that doesn't bother me. The armor designs themselves I feel is subjective. I'm not a fan of them, but I manage to find something I like here and there. I agree with the brutes, and I would like to add on the Flood too. Bungie made good use of them by using them to change the way you engaged enemies and combat pacing. 343 added the Promethians, but these new enemies show up in the beginning of the games rather than midway through, unlike the way Bungie did it. By introducing new enemies later in the game (like Flood and Brutes), it keeps the player engaged and surprised even late in the game. What I feel Halo has been really lacking since 343 took over is [i]personality[/i]. Look at Buck in Halo 5, then look at Cayde in the Destiny 2 trailer. It's Nathan Fillion in both roles, but which one is he far more entertaining in? I like Locke as a character: he's smart, cooperative, cool under pressure, the definition of a leader; but he has no [i]personality[/i]! The same goes for Chief, Didact, and Cortana; they sound good on paper, but end up coming up short in practice. There are those with character, and those that are characters; 343's gotta work on that. While I'm at it (apologies for the length of this post), 343 Halos take themselves too seriously. Bungie often incorporated humor without breaking tone, giving dimension to their characters. That may solve the personality thing too.

            • 343 is obviously capable of making Halo 6 great. People hate on the new art style, I personally like it, but 343 is more than capable of making the older art styles with modern fidelity: i.e. Halo CEA, Halo 2A and Halo Wars 2. Forge is better than ever in 5, switching from stupid World Units to feet as the measurement, so really other than perhaps some more logic chain options there's not much to improve. The campaign in 5 was mediocre at best. In 4, the story was pretty incredible but a plot hole appears in the first 30 seconds of gameplay, in the form of the intro scene with the Spartans having the same armour that John wears during 4. The explanation for John receiving this new armour was because of nano bots upgrading his armour, but as for the other Spartans, this is canonically incorrect because the cutscene takes place before Halo CE. The explanation I could find for this was simply that 343 ran out of time to use the correct armour set because the 3 year cycle of Halo releases was broken after Reach. Another thing about this cutscene is that John receives Cortana from Dr. Halsey, but we know that Captain Keys gave John Cortana, and that Halsey was never on the Pillar of Autumn. The gameplay in 4 suffered the same way it did in 5, with the latter landing itself in a weird plot hole for its story. This is the major point for me that must be improved. The formula for multiplayer in 5 has two modes: Arena and Warzone, which appeal to Halo 3's and 4's audiences respectively. The problem is how the Req system is implemented. Armour is no longer tied to challenges, and it is the way it was in 3, with only the colours, visor, helmet and armour customizable. This is an easy fix, as all that is needed to do is split the armour sets up like they did in 4. As for the challenge based unlocks, once again could be modelled after 4; perhaps removing armour entirely from the Reqs would be the way to go. As for vehicles and all else, I'm not really sure what could be done here if the theme of Reqs and Warzone will still be present in 6. As for abilities, I actually like all of them, and base movement speed is actually the fastest in Halo 5 than any other Halo. Sprint is a debatable topic; this is the one "ability" that many disagree with and I understand why. Due to the large nature of the maps combined with the high base movement speed, this creates the illusion of speed; in Arena, it's a different story. These are all just my two cents, but also some suggestions for Halo 6. TL;DR: I want 343 to be successful in developing the next Halo because they have the potential to do so in their actions with H2A and HW2 but fell short with Halo 4 and 5.
